Vallée De Mai Nature Reserve

Located in the center of Praslin, Vallée de Mai is probably one of the most picturesque nature reserves in the world. It is an incredible rainforest where you will feel like you’ve stepped back in time, and you’ll find stunning varieties of palm trees, birds (such as Seychelles warblers), reptiles, insects and more.

To make your experience even better, Vallée de Mai is home to six species of palm that are exclusive to Seychelles, making it an incredibly valuable area in terms of biodiversity. Among them is the legendary Coco de Mer – an iconic palm tree bearing the world’s largest fruit, weighing up to 25 kilos!
